CMDB 配置管理系统的支持程度可能因具体的系统而有所不同,但一些现代的CMDB 配置管理系统提供了对机器学习和人工智能技术的支持。以下是一些CMDB 配置管理系统中可能应用机器学习和人工智能技术的方面:自动化数据处理:CMDB 配置管理系统可以使用机器学习技术来处理大量的配置项数据。通过机器学习算法,系统可以从数据中提取有价值的关联信息、模式和趋势,以实现自动化的数据处理和分析。配置项关系发现:机器学习算法可以用于帮助发现配置项之间的关联关系。通过分析大量的配置项数据,系统可以识别出隐藏的关系,例如依赖关系、影响关系和拓扑关系,从而更好地理解配置项之间的相互作用。自动化事件管理:人工智能技术可以应用于CMDB 配置管理系统中的事件管理。通过机器学习算法和自然语言处理技术,系统可以自动识别和分类事件,进行自动化的事件处理和响应。故障预测和性能优化:利用机器学习和人工智能技术,CMDB 配置管理系统可以进行故障预测和性能优化。通过分析历史数据和监控指标,系统可以预测设备或服务的故障概率,并采取相应的措施来优化性能和可靠性。CMDB 配置管理系统可以帮助用户快速定位和确定故障的根源,方便用户及时做出响应和处理。河北后台配置管理系统定制
CMDB 配置管理系统本身是配置管理数据库,它的主要目的是为组织提供对配置项的识别、记录、控制和管理。工作流程管理通常超出了CMDB 配置管理系统的基本功能范围,因此CMDB 配置管理系统可能需要与其他工作流程管理工具或平台集成,以支持更复杂的工作流程和流程管理需求。通过与工作流程管理工具的集成,可以在配置管理流程中引入工作流程并实现自动化的流程引导、任务分配、审批流程、状态跟踪等功能。这样可以更好地控制和管理配置项的整个生命周期,从配置项的创建和变更请求到审批和发布。具体支持工作流程管理的能力将取决于CMDB 配置管理系统的版本和所选择的工作流程管理工具。某些版本的CMDB 配置管理系统可能已经集成了基本的工作流程管理功能,而其他版本可能需要通过自定义集成或插件来实现。河北后台配置管理系统定制CMDB 配置管理系统可以对配置项进行分类和统计,方便用户统计和分析配置信息。
CMDB配置管理系统通常支持配置项的分组管理。分组管理是指将相关的配置项归类到逻辑上的组或类别中,以方便管理和组织配置项数据。通过配置项的分组管理,可以实现以下目标:组织和层次化:配置项可以按功能、服务、环境等逻辑属性进行分组。这样可以将相似的配置项组织在一起,形成层次化的结构,便于团队理解和管理。访问控制:不同组别的配置项可以赋予不同的访问权限。这样可以限制某些配置项的访问权,只允许特定的用户或团队查看和修改。统一管理:分组管理可以帮助团队将配置项集中管理。通过配置项的逻辑分组,可以更好地了解配置项之间的关系,减少数据冗余和重复,并提高配置项数据的整体一致性和准确性。
许多CMDB 配置管理系统支持云原生部署。云原生部署是一种将应用程序和服务设计为在云环境中运行的方法,它利用云计算的弹性、可伸缩性和灵活性。以下是CMDB 配置管理系统支持云原生部署的一些常见方式:容器化部署:CMDB 配置管理系统可以通过容器化的方式进行部署,使用容器编排技术如Docker和Kubernetes。将CMDB 配置管理系统的各个组件封装成容器,可以方便地在云环境中进行部署、扩展和管理。自动化部署:通过自动化工具和脚本,可以实现CMDB 配置管理系统的自动化部署和配置。例如,使用Infrastructure as Code (IaC) 工具,如Terraform、Ansible等,可以定义和管理CMDB 配置管理系统的基础设施和资源。云服务集成:CMDB 配置管理系统可以与云提供商的服务集成,利用云平台提供的服务和功能。例如,可以连接到云服务提供商的API,自动获取云资源的配置信息并更新到CMDB 配置管理系统中。弹性扩展和自动伸缩:利用云平台的弹性和自动伸缩功能,可以根据需求扩展CMDB 配置管理系统的资源和容量。CMDB 配置管理系统可以支持容器和微服务的管理,包括Docker、Kubernetes等。
大多数CMDB 配置管理系统都支持API接口。通过API接口,CMDB 配置管理系统可以与其他系统和工具进行集成和交互,实现数据的共享和自动化操作。以下是CMDB 配置管理系统 API接口的一些常见应用:数据集成:CMDB 配置管理系统的API可以用于数据的导入和导出。它可以与其他系统、自动化工具或脚本进行集成,实现数据的自动同步和更新。例如,可以通过API接口将外部系统中的配置项数据导入到CMDB 配置管理系统中,或将CMDB 配置管理系统中的数据导出到其他系统进行使用。自动化操作:通过API接口,可以对CMDB 配置管理系统中的配置项数据进行自动化操作,如创建、更新、删除等。这样可以方便地集成CMDB 配置管理系统功能到自动化工作流或脚本中,实现自动化的配置项管理和操作。数据查询和报告:CMDB 配置管理系统的API接口可以用于查询和检索配置项数据。通过编写查询请求,可以获取特定配置项的信息,进行数据分析和生成报告。这样可以方便地集成CMDB 配置管理系统数据到其他系统或自定义报告中。CMDB 配置管理系统可以对配置项进行状态管理,方便用户了解配置项当前的状态和可用性。浙江服务配置管理系统厂
CMDB 配置管理系统可以对系统的变更和配置项进行审计和记录,方便用户进行追溯和解决问题。河北后台配置管理系统定制
CMDB 配置管理系统通常支持高可用和负载均衡来确保系统的可用性和性能。以下是CMDB 配置管理系统可能提供的高可用和负载均衡功能:高可用性:CMDB 配置管理系统可以通过在多个服务器之间分布和复制数据,以实现高可用性。当一个服务器发生故障或不可用时,其他服务器可以接管服务,确保系统的连续性和可用性。高可用性的实现通常依赖于主从复制、集群部署或活动-活动的架构。负载均衡:CMDB 配置管理系统可以通过负载均衡来分发请求并平衡服务器的负载,以提高系统的性能和响应能力。负载均衡器会根据预定的算法将请求分发给不同的服务器,确保每个服务器都能充分利用其资源,减轻单个服务器的压力。故障切换:CMDB 配置管理系统可能支持故障切换功能,即当一个服务器发生故障或不可用时,系统可以自动切换到备用服务器上。这可以通过自动检测故障并重新分配请求来实现,以非常小化对系统的影响并保持服务的连续性。水平扩展:CMDB 配置管理系统可以支持水平扩展,即通过增加更多的服务器来提高系统的容量和性能。水平扩展可以根据需求增加服务器,以处理更多的请求和数据负载。河北后台配置管理系统定制